When the men who walked on the moon walked through Chicago

Summary by Usa News
In August of 1969, Chicago welcomed Neil Armstrong, Edwin “Buzz” Aldrin Jr. and Michael Collins to the city only a few weeks after their stop on the moon. Confetti cascaded down from skyscrapers in a ticker-tape parade and millions lined the streets of Chicago’s financial district to get a glimpse of the three Apollo 11 astronauts.
